Overview Weltelmi MT 25mg Tablet
Telmisartan 25mg tablets effectively manage hypertension, reducing the risk of cardiovascular events like strokes and heart attacks. Prompt treatment improves heart attack survival rates. Consistent blood levels are achieved by taking this medication daily with food at the same time, as directed by your physician. Continued use, even when feeling well, is crucial as high blood pressure is often asymptomatic; premature discontinuation can worsen the condition. Lifestyle modifications such as regular exercise, weight management, and a balanced diet further enhance blood pressure control. Adhere strictly to your doctor's instructions. Potential side effects include headache, weakness, dizziness, hypotension (occasionally with fainting), elevated potassium levels, shortness of breath, nausea, vomiting, stomach pain, and tiredness. Avoid potassium-rich foods and supplements. Dizziness may occur; avoid driving and rise slowly from a seated position. Regular monitoring of blood pressure, blood sugar, kidney function, and electrolyte levels may be required. Inform your doctor of any kidney or liver issues before starting this medication. Pregnant or breastfeeding individuals should seek medical advice prior to use. Always disclose all other medications, especially those for hypertension or heart problems, to your doctor.

SAFETY ADVICE
AlcoholUNSAFE
Consuming alcohol alongside Weltelmi MT 25mg Tablet is inadvisable.
PregnancyC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
Use of Weltelmi MT 25mg tablets during pregnancy poses a confirmed risk to fetal development and is therefore contraindicated. In exceptional circumstances involving life-threatening conditions, a physician might prescribe it if the potential benefits outweigh the known risks. Physician consultation is essential.
Breast feedingSAFE IF PRESCRIBED
Administration of Weltelmi MT 25mg tablets during lactation appears to pose minimal risk. Available human data indicate negligible infant hazard.
DrivingUNSAFE
Taking a Weltelmi MT 25mg Tablet might reduce alertness, impair vision, and cause drowsiness or dizziness. Driving should be avoided if these effects are experienced.
KidneySAFE IF PRESCRIBED
Kidney impairment does not necessitate a dosage change for Weltelmi MT 25mg Tablets; their use is considered safe in such patients.
LiverCAUTION
Patients with liver impairment should use Weltelmi MT 25mg Tablets cautiously; dosage modification may be necessary. Physician consultation is advised.
